A 7,500-square-foot mixed-use building in Hamilton has been sold to Comfort Keepers, an in-home care services firm, for $1 million, according to an announcement from Fennelly Associates.
Jerry Fennelly, president of Fennelly Associates, and Patrick Dintrone represented the owner in the transaction with the buyer.
Located at 2670 Nottingham Way, the retail and warehouse building is conveniently located near Interstate 295. The property boasts 23 on-site surface parking spaces, prominent signage, a bus stop located in front of the building, a drive-in door, 12-foot clear ceiling heights in the office and retail portion of the building and a 12-foot-7 ceiling in the warehouse space.
